Architectural richness and beauty of the historic city center, caring attitude of citizens to buildings and private property allowed the city to get into the list of the UNESCO concerning places of historical significance. Český Krumlov castle, which was built on the rock, has a terrace from which you can see numerous tiled roofs, narrow winding streets, wooden bridges, a water mill and the bend of the Vltava river. On the territory of the second largest castle of Czech Republic (the biggest one is the Prague castle), which was built in the XIV century, you will see a large rose garden, Plášťový most, an ancient Baroque theater, which works only a few times a year. Time has stopped here. Indeed, over the past 200-300 years the city's appearance has not changed. In search of real medieval romance and a sight for sore eyes tourists rush here from the most distant corners of the world to visit the historic center, which is listed as the World Heritage Site and to visit the Town Hall, which was built in XVI century, also tourists got many other places to visit here.
No trip to Český Krumlov can be done without a visit to the medieval gothic Hluboká Castle, which is a real jewel in the crown of the Czech Republic located in the town of Hluboká nad Vltavou. The ancestorial castle of the English royal Windsor dynasty was the prototype for the castle in the form in which we can now see it. Refined white gothic towers and high-faceted walls remind of a bride who put on her wedding dress.

- In June, "Five-petalled Rose Celebrations" take place in Český Krumlov. Real medieval knights and ladies come to the streets. The city gets back in the Renaissance era for three days. This spectacle deserves special attention.
